If you love coloring and florals you will love the Floral Frame and the Floral Frame dies! I loved working with these and the stamps are perfect alone as a one layer card, but certainly, are brought to life with some die cutting and dimension.
For my card, I colored and cut the frame out and added foam tape to the floral part of the frame. I also colored and cut several of the single flower images and layered them on top of the image I had already colored to give more floral dimension. All of this was adhered to a black cardstock panel, then onto a card base where I had added a black and white striped border to make it pop.
